Explanation: MPF also known as mitosis promoting factor is the cyclin-CDK complex, It stimulates the mitotic and meiotic phases of the cell cycle. MPF promotes the entrance into mitosis (the M phase) from the G2 phase by phosphorylating multiple proteins needed during mitosis. MPF is activated at the end of G2 by a phosphatase, which removes an inhibitory phosphate group added earlier during the cycle.
MPF is composed of two subunits:
Cyclin-dependent kinase 1 (CDK1), the cyclin-dependent kinase subunit uses ATP to phosphorylate specific serine and threonine residues of target proteins.
Cyclin is a regulatory subunit. The cyclins helps to regulate the function of the kinase subunit with the appropriate substrate. The mitotic cyclins can be grouped as cyclins A & B. These cyclins have 9 residue sequence in the N-terminal region called the “destruction box”, which can be recognized by the ubiquitin ligase enzyme which destroys the cyclins when appropriate.
The process of mitosis, or cell division, is also known as the M phase. This is where the cell divides its previously-copied DNA and cytoplasm to make two new, identical daughter cells. Mitosis consists of four basic phases: prophase, metaphase, anaphase, and telophase.
